The Complex Analysis Seminar is centered on complex analysis and its interactions with other areas of mathematics. Its principal interests include analysis on metric measure spaces, geometric function theory and complex dynamics. Geometric connections encompass Riemann surfaces, Kleinian groups, hyperbolic geometry, Teichmüller theory, and geometric group theory. At the interface with probability, the seminar will explore random geometry and its connections with complex analysis. Possible topics include the geometry of Brownian motion and related random spaces; random curves and loops described by Schramm–Loewner evolution and conformal loop ensembles; and random fields, measures, and surfaces studied through the Gaussian free field, Gaussian multiplicative chaos, and Liouville quantum gravity. Beyond complex analysis, the seminar will also explore topics from related fields, such as harmonic analysis, geometric measure theory, and fractal geometry, reflecting participants’ broader mathematical interests.
